RV and trailer season is here: bylaw reminder from the CSO program
© DiscoverHumboldt

As summer begins, Humboldt Community Safety Officers are reminding residents of parking and storage bylaws for RVs and trailers. Under city traffic bylaw amendments, RVs and trailers cannot be parked on residential streets for more than 48 hours and must be removed for at least 48 hours before returning. Regulations also specify where vehicles can be parked relative to sidewalks and curbs. CSO states that following the rules helps prevent congestion and improves safety in residential areas.

Byerly RV Highlights RV Towing Safety and Operational Awareness for Seasonal Travel

Missouri-based dealer Byerly RV has emphasized the importance of proper towing practices as the peak RV travel season begins. The company notes that stability and handling depend on hitch setup, cargo distribution, and vehicle readiness. Pre-trip inspections of tire pressure, brakes, and weight ratings are recommended to improve safety on the road.

Recreational vehicle catches fire in Victoriaville

On Monday afternoon, a recreational vehicle parked in a yard on Boulevard des Bois-Francs Nord in Victoriaville caught fire. Firefighters were called around 4:30 PM and responded under the command of Captain Stéphane Michaud. The fire produced thick black smoke before being extinguished. Further details are pending.
